Who are the Woking Wizards?

We are a friendly, local team with players over the age of 17 and various abilities.
Training is currently on Monday evenings and is from 7.45pm to 9pm at Woking Leisure Centre.
We will be competing in the Woking Winter and Summer leagues and matches are played on Tuesday evenings at Winston Churchill School, Woking.

 

 
 

What is Netball?

Netball is a non-contact generally indoor sport similar to, and derived from, basketball. It is usually known as a women's sport. It was originally known in its country of origin, the United States, as "women's basketball". Invented in 1895 by Clara Gregory Baer, a pioneer in women's sport, netball is now the pre-eminent women's team sport (both as a spectator and participant sport) in Australia, New Zealand and South Africa and is popular in the West Indies, Sri Lanka, and the United Kingdom. Over 20 million people play netball in more than 70 countries.
